Financial Crime Prevention Specialist
2 weeks ago
At Citi, you'll have the opportunity to expand your skills and make a difference at one of the world's most global banks. Our Global Legal Affairs and Compliance team empowers and protects Citi by providing legal, compliance, investigative, and security services to our firm.
About the RoleThe Compliance Anti Money Laundering Risk Management Officer is a senior professional level role responsible for establishing internal procedures to prevent money laundering and assist in all matters concerning financial crimes in coordination with the broader Anti-Money Laundering (AML) team.
The overall objective is to utilize established disciplinary knowledge to identify inconsistencies in data or results and formulate strategic recommendations on policies, procedures, and practices.
Key Responsibilities- Identify, vet, and address potential risks or escalated issues with the assistance of functional partners
- Collaborate with the team to provide advice to business with respect to applicability of policies and implementation of AML program and regulatory changes
- Provide input/advice on business initiatives, new products, and complex transactions
- Supervise and participate in internal assurance processes such as Enterprise wide AML risk assessment, self-assessment, and internal audit
- Promote global consistency of AML ACRM practices and policies within business line and cross-sector
- Analyze data, prepare and present regional/global reports related to AML risk assessments, and monitor AML related issues and escalations
- Develop and implement AML Compliance Risk Management (ACRM) standards and policies
- Appropriately assess risk when business decisions are made, demonstrating particular consideration for the firm's reputation and safeguarding Citigroup, its clients, and assets, by driving compliance with applicable laws, rules, and regulations, adhering to Policy, applying sound ethical judgment regarding personal behavior, conduct, and business practices, and escalating, managing, and reporting control issues with transparency.
- 6-10 years of experience
- Anti-Money Laundering (AML) certification required
- Working knowledge of regulatory requirements including local, US, and international laws
- Working knowledge of industry standards and practices
- Consistently demonstrates clear and concise written and verbal communication
